Do your bit by joining as a Storeperson at our Nigg Waste Water Treatment Works.
What you’ll do
Have the ability to manage the busy demands of the logistics sites goods in and out movements.
You’ll ensure that essential maintenance parts are dispatched to site in a timely manner to sustain ER craft and contractors with materials for completing work on site.
Liaise with Team Leaders to ensure timely delivery of parts to site.
You’ll have the ability to assess the criticality of parts as they arrive at Site and understand the technical terminology to ensure that equipment is catalogued and stored appropriately.
This requires you to interrogate several different corporate and supplier IT systems, including SAP.
Where sufficient details are not available, you must investigate the equipment and using their technical understanding, and network of internal and industry contacts, gather the required technical specifications to satisfy the corporate systems.
